Bryan Reyna, the 27-year-old winger for Universitario de Deportes, has seen his market value drop to €700,000 following a quiet Torneo Apertura 2026. According to Libero.pe, the player’s valuation fell by €300,000 because of a lack of offensive contribution while playing on loan from Belgrano.
Why did Bryan Reyna’s market value drop so significantly?
The decline is directly linked to his performance during the first stage of the 2026 championship. While Reyna arrived with high expectations, he struggled to secure a consistent role in the starting lineup. Recent updates from Transfermarkt indicate that his impact on the Universitario attack was essentially non-existent during the Torneo Apertura.
The financial impact is stark. While his value recently dipped from €1 million to €700,000, the long-term trend is even more concerning for the winger. When he moved from Alianza Lima to Belgrano, his market valuation reached a peak of €2.5 million. He has now lost a massive portion of that peak value as his playing time diminished.
At his career peak, Bryan Reyna was valued at €2.5 million. His current valuation of €700,000 represents a loss of approximately €1.8 million in market worth.
What happens next for Reyna at Universitario de Deportes?
Despite the recent devaluation, Reyna has not been discarded. He remains a member of the main squad as the club prepares for the Copa de la Liga and the upcoming Torneo Clausura 2026. His future depends heavily on how he performs in the next phase of the season.
Head coach Héctor Cúper is currently in a period of observation. According to reports, Cúper has not yet made any radical decisions regarding the roster. He is using training sessions to closely monitor the players before deciding who will lead the team in the Clausura tournament.
For Reyna, the upcoming weeks are a fight for relevance. He needs to prove he can provide the offensive spark that Transfermarkt noted was missing during the Apertura.
How has Bryan Reyna’s career progressed through different clubs?
Reyna’s journey has taken him through various tiers of football, including stints in Spain and Argentina. His career path shows a player who has experienced both high-level opportunities and periods of transition.
His professional history includes stints at the following clubs:
- Cantolao
- Mallorca
- CD Toledo
- Alcoyano
- Barakaldo CF
- Las Rozas
- Alianza Lima
- Belgrano
- Universitario de Deportes
